Rankdesk's Investment Rating combines the net yield of a property with a projected 5-year capital appreciation. A score from 1 to 5 is given to the property depending on how it's net yield and capital appreciation compare with the values of other London properties rated by Rankdesk in 2011.

The Chelsea Barracks redevelopment will become one of London's most significant residential neighbourhoods. The area will also benefit from the development of the new Chelsea Academy, which will provide world-class education for approximately 1060 pupils and students. The Academy specialising in sciences intends to develop close links with the museums, universities and similar institutions located in the Royal Borough of Kensington and Chelsea.

How to use this page: Look at the first section to determine whether the property is underpriced or overpriced compared to the neighbourhood average. All prices are based on asking prices. Use the property quality diagram to determine if this price and rent difference is warranted. A buyer would typically expect that a property that is priced above the neighbourhood average would also be of better quality compared to neighbouring properties. Finally look at the supply and demand values in the neighbourhood. Typically the price per square foot of a property is higher when there is low property supply and high demand in the area.
